Log in at wherever ’s DNS records are edited and add one record. The screen is called DNS records, Advanced DNS or Zone editor depending on the host; the record is the same everywhere.
| Field | What to enter | |
|---|---|---|
| Type | A | |
| Name or Host | @ (some hosts want it blank, or ) | home |
| Value, Points to, or Address | the server’s IP address from step 4 | |
| TTL | leave the default |
Save it. The change takes anywhere from a few minutes to a few hours to spread across the internet, and the server watches for it: the moment your name reaches it, it fetches its own certificate and switches the padlock on. Nothing to press.

Everything works from there, and the padlock catches up on its own.Your site opens its setup wizard the first time you log in. Each screen explains itself, so go through them in order. Do not skip the email screen: a password reset email is the way back into your account, and a brand new site cannot send one until mail is configured.
Have ready to paste: the SMTP2GO key from step 2, and the Backblaze bucket name and key from step 5. The Linode token is already in place — the wizard uses it once to add your mail records, then deletes it.
